摘要: 为解决沿海吹填区人工测量困难,测量点精度和密度无法满足高精度吹填量计算需求,本文结合实际案例,采用无人机机载激光雷达点云数据进行吹填量计算,提出了一套适用于沿海吹填区无人机机载激光雷达点云分类、高精度数字高程模型(DEM)建模及吹填量计算的完整技术流程,具有较强的可参考性。结果表明,无人机激光雷达技术能够高效解决沿海吹填工程高精度吹填量计算问题,具有显著的应用优势和广阔的发展前景。

Abstract: In order to solve the difficulties of manual surveying of coastal reclamation areas,the accuracy and density of points can not meet the needs of high-precision reclamation calculation,this paper uses the UAV airborne LiDAR point cloud to calculate the reclamation amount and presents a complete technical flow which is suitable for UAV airborne LiDAR point cloud classification,high precision digital elevation model modeling and calculation of the amount of blow fill in coastal reclamation area.The results show that the UAV LiDAR technology can effectively solve the problem of high-precision calculation of the amount of blow fill in coastal reclamation projects,and has significant application advantages and broad development prospects.
